More changes coming to college sports

Arkansas Democrat-Gazette 19 May 2024
Further, another part of the settlement will remove the NCAA's scholarship limits for each sport ... By terms of the settlement, roster limits will be set for each sport, and schools will be able to offer as many scholarships as they'd like.

Here's how to apply for a youth recreation scholarship from the park board this summer

Springfield News-Leader 18 May 2024
The Springfield-Greene County Park Board Youth Recreation Scholarship Fund offers scholarships for youth to participate in sports, summer camps, and other programs designed to build skills, confidence, and a healthy lifestyle.
